American Style Fridge Freezer

willow-wsbs84ds-american-style-side-by-side-fridge-freezer-with-non-plumbed-water-dispenser-in-silver-2-year-warranty-frost-free-430-litre-capacity-energy-saving-inverter-motor-65.jpgThe American fridge freezer gives you plenty of storage space and can make the perfect statement in your kitchen. They can hold between 11 and 36 shopping bags of food. This is perfect for larger families or people who cook.

They have twice the space as normal UK fridge freezers and come with fantastic features like total no frost. They have a sleek, modern design.

Size

american non plumbed fridge freezer-style fridge freezers are generally larger than their British counterparts that allow you to store and keep cool more food until you're ready enjoy it. They're great if you have a large family, are cooking for a lot of guests or require more storage space for cooking batches and frozen meals.

A double-door American fridge freezer is stylish thanks to its large storage capacity and double-door design. The models are available in a variety of colors, including white for a classic appearance, elegant silver and polished black to match modern decor. Some even come with built-in dispensers for water and ice to help you get chilled drinks and american non plumbed fridge freezer instant ice easier However, be aware that these devices can be a threat to freezer storage space.

There are also models with door racks that hold bottles, jars and cartons. They're easy to grab. And some have adjustable height shelves to fit taller milk bottles or tins of fizzy pop. Certain models come with water jugs which you can fill at the tap, reducing plumbing costs and eliminating the need to connect them to water pipes.

If you're buying a plug-in in model, check the dimensions of the fridge against existing kitchen cabinets or measurements of your space before delivery. You'll also need to determine your route into your home and measure any doors, hallways or corners the fridge will need to pass through.

Functionality

big american fridge freezer fridge freezers are designed to make a bold design impact in your kitchen. They are available in a variety contemporary finishes, ranging from stainless steel to black and graphite. Modern freezers employ different technologies to ensure optimal performance, energy efficiency and free of frost.

The fridge can hold 173 Liters, while the freezer holds 367 litres. This is enough space to accommodate 20 grocery bags worth of shopping, which makes them ideal for large families or those who love entertaining.

A lot of models come with an automatic Ice maker built into the freezer section to supply a ready supply of cubes, and some even offer crushed ice! There are also models with chilled water dispensers built into the refrigerator doors that provide instant, cold filtered water at the touch of one button. These models usually need to be connected to your mains water supply but there are non-plumbed options if you're unable to access the water pipes easily.

Other features include MultiAirFlow ventilation which helps keep the temperature even across the appliance and smart screens that allow you to make grocery lists and browse recipes. Certain models also come with Holiday Mode to keep the appliance running efficiently when you're away, an effective method to cut down on your energy costs!
